What Makes Essential Oils Antibacterial?

Essential oils derive their antibacterial properties from bioactive compounds such as terpenes, phenols, and aldehydes. These compounds disrupt bacterial cell membranes, inhibit cell division, and prevent the growth of harmful microbes. Top Antibacterial Essential Oils

  1. Tea Tree Oil Tea tree oil (Melaleuca alternifolia) is one of the most studied essential oils for its antibacterial properties. Its high concentration of terpinen-4-ol makes it effective against a range of bacteria, including Staphylococcus aureus and E. coli. It is commonly used in skincare products to treat acne and infections.
  2. Eucalyptus Oil Eucalyptus oil contains 1,8-cineole, a compound known for its antimicrobial properties. This oil is widely used in respiratory therapies and cleaning solutions to eliminate bacteria and freshen the air.
  3. Lavender Oil Beyond its calming aroma, lavender oil exhibits strong antibacterial effects, particularly against gram-positive bacteria. It is often used in wound care and to prevent skin infections.
  4. Clove Oil Clove essential oil’s primary compound, eugenol, is a powerful antibacterial agent. It is effective in oral health applications, such as treating toothaches and preventing gum infections.
  5. Lemon Oil Lemon oil is rich in d-limonene, making it a potent antibacterial agent. It is frequently added to cleaning products and diffused to purify indoor air.
  6. Peppermint Oil Peppermint oil combines antibacterial action with a cooling sensation, making it ideal for soothing skin irritations and alleviating minor infections.

Safety Considerations

While essential oils are natural, their potency requires careful usage. Always dilute essential oils with a carrier oil before applying them to the skin to avoid irritation. Perform a patch test to check for allergies and consult a healthcare professional for internal use.
